  • According to the IRS, an astounding $1.5 billion in tax refunds for the year 2019 remain unclaimed 🤯Yes, you read that right - a staggering amount of money that could be rightfully yours is still waiting to be claimed. But don’t worry, there’s still time to grab your share! 💰
    ⏰ Act now! You have until July 17 to file your 2019 taxes and lay claim to your long-overdue refund. This golden opportunity is knocking on your door, and it’s time to answer.
    Wondering how much you could get? Well, the median unclaimed refund stands at a cool $893, but that’s not all! If you’re eligible for the Earned Income Tax Credit, you could be in for a windfall of up to $6,557. That’s money you definitely don’t want to miss out on💸
    To secure your 2019 refund, here’s what you need to do: carefully address, mail, and postmark your tax return by July 17. And remember, filing for 2019 isn’t the end of the road - make sure to file for tax years 2020, 2021, and 2022
    Keep in mind that unclaimed refunds vary from state to state. In fact, California alone has an astonishing $141.8 million just waiting to be claimed. Imagine what that could do for you!
